For scheduling DOT drug or alcohol tests in Patton Village, TX, call us at (800) 221-4291 or use our online system. Select your test, fill out donor details, and register before visiting.
Your zip code identifies the nearest suitable testing center in Patton Village, TX. After registration, receive a form with location and details. Bring it to the center; no need for appointments, though payment is required upfront.
Our labs hold SAMHSA certification, guaranteeing test accuracy verified by Medical Review Officers.
